Shiraz and Grenache Blend
The Shiraz grape contributes depth, colour and concentrated flavour to the blend. Originally associated with southern France, Shiraz is known for its rich aromas and full-bodied character. Grenache, meanwhile, brings finesse, elegance and a softer aromatic profile. Originally from Spain, this red grape variety typically produces wines with moderate colour intensity and delicate, refined aromas.
Together, these varieties create a well-rounded rosé that combines richness with refreshing acidity. The palate is generous and full-bodied, while lively acidity keeps the wine fresh and balanced. Furthermore, the finish is pleasantly persistent, leaving an attractive impression after every sip.
Carefully Controlled Winemaking
The grapes were harvested on 24 August and 3 September 2023. After picking, they remained for 12 hours in specialised refrigerated chambers to help preserve their freshness and aromatic character. The grapes then underwent destemming, crushing and a pre-fermentation cold maceration lasting 12–18 hours at 8–10°C.
After static clarification of the must, selected yeast was introduced to begin alcoholic fermentation. Fermentation took place at a controlled temperature of 15–16°C and lasted approximately 22–25 days. This careful approach helps retain the wine’s fresh fruit character and vibrant aromatic profile.
Food Pairing and Serving
Kyperounda Rose is particularly versatile at the table. Its freshness and generous fruit profile make it an excellent pairing for seafood, pasta dishes, white meats and creamy cheeses. It is equally enjoyable as an aperitif, especially during warm summer evenings or relaxed gatherings.
For the best experience, serve Kyperounda Rose chilled at 8–10°C. The wine is intended to be enjoyed within the first two years of its life, when its fresh and aromatic character is at its most expressive.
